Is £2m a year low for a PL manager?
If you believe what you find online (so buyer beware, could easily all be nonsense etc) then yes it.

Seems lowest end is the £1.5m range for Andrews and Parker, a lot in the £2m - £4m range, then you're into the likes of Moyes, Howe, Slot, Emery going somewhere between £6m and £8m, then the biggest wages for Arteta (c.£10m) and Pep (anywhere up to around £20m).

So reckon RLB may realistically want another £1m p/y and be justified in asking for it.
